About this contract

This contract is for a series of works in Nairobi and Nanyuki to facilitate appropriate Emergency Water supply at Key locations. The work includes demolition of existing infrastructure, Installation of water supply tanks and pump units and replacement of inadequate water supply pipework. The Authority will score the Potential Provider’s response to each question based on its assessment of the evidence provided by the Potential Provider as detailed below: Award Criteria and Evaluation Methodology Except where indicated below, responses will be allocated a PASS / FAIL mark, YES / NO mark or a Score ranging from 0 to 4 in accordance with the following categories: a. Pass / Fail Question. If a “FAIL” is noted for any questions assessed on a “PASS / FAIL” basis, your inclusion on the Tender List may be precluded, subject to verification by the evaluation team. b. Yes / No Question. If a “NO” is noted for any questions assessed on a YES / NO basis, your inclusion on the Tender List should not be precluded, however this is subject to verification by the evaluation team. c. 0 - Non-Compliant. No response, unacceptable or insufficient information provided upon which to make a reasonable assessment. Response fails to provide confidence and demonstrates fundamental misunderstanding of the requirement. d. 1 - Less than Satisfactory. Response is limited; it lacks detail, credibility and/or explanation, and demonstrates only a basic understanding of the requirement. Partial responses provided, not linked to the key attributes of the questions - anecdotal in parts. The response provides limited evidence of processes, procedures, roles/responsibilities and professional competency. The answer contains ambiguities or deficiencies that cannot be tolerated. e. 2 - Adequate Response. Response demonstrates a satisfactory understanding of the requirement. The response outlines clear roles and responsibilities, with adequate level of professional competency. Response includes some key processes and procedures, linked to key attributes of the questions and demonstrates a reasonably acceptable approach that covers most areas, however, lacks depth and supporting evidence. f. 3 - Good Response. The response is sufficiently detailed to demonstrate a good understanding of the requirement. The response provides details of team resources in terms of qualifications / experience aligned to roles and responsibilities, demonstrating a good spread of professional competencies and addresses the arrangements through the Stakeholder group. Demonstrable approach that is clear and consistent. Processes and procedures are reasonably well explained and logical. Response is clear, verifiable and covers all key attributes of the question. g. 4 - Excellent / Ideal Response. The response is comprehensive, unambiguous and demonstrates a strong understanding of the requirement. Approach is detailed and includes robust and effective measures, with processes and procedures being clearly explained and perfectly logical. It provides specific details of team resource that clearly demonstrates a full spread of professional competencies and works experience throughout the Stakeholder group. Clear and fully verifiable evidence provided that covers all attributes, providing high degree of confidence in ability to deliver. The response identifies specific commendations/awards achieved in relation to the question being answered, that can be verified by the evaluation team. The response clearly demonstrates the ability to benefit from lessons learnt throughout the life cycle of the project.
